What kind of football player is Radamel Falcao?

Radamel Falcao García Zárate ( Spanish pronunciation: [raðaˈmel falˈkao]; 10 February 1986) is a Colombian professional footballer who plays as a forward for Süper Lig club Galatasaray and the Colombia national team. He is sometimes nicknamed ” El Tigre ” (Spanish for The Tiger) or “King of the Europa League “.

When did Radamel Falcao score a penalty for Colombia?

Falcao scored a penalty against Peru in the 13th minute where Colombia won 2–0. On 11 October 2013, in the penultimate World Cup qualifying match against Chile, Falcao scored twice from penalty kicks to tie 3–3 after trailing 0–3. This result ensured Colombia qualified for the World Cup for the first time since 1998.

When did Radamel Falcao sign for Manchester United?

On 1 September 2014, Manchester United agreed to sign Falcao on loan for £6 million subject to a medical examination with an option to sign permanently for £43.5 million (€55 million) at season’s end. The deal saw him earn £265,000 per week at the club.

Where did Radamel Falcao finish in the Ballon d’Or?

Falcao finished as top goalscorer for the second straight year and became the first player to win consecutive Europa League titles with two teams. He was named in the FIFA FIFPro World XI in 2012, and finished in fifth place for the 2012 FIFA Ballon d’Or .

When did Radamel Falcao get his first hat trick?

On 7 November, he scored twice (one of them a backheel goal) in a 5–0 victory against the defending champions Benfica. On 2 December, Falcao scored his first hat-trick for Porto against Rapid Wien during a UEFA Europa League clash, becoming the top goal scorer with seven goals.

When did Radamel Falcao move to Porto from Lyon?

Falcao moved to Europe on 15 July 2009 to join Porto of the Portuguese Primeira Liga for a €3.93 million transfer fee for 60% of his economic rights after Porto sold striker Lisandro López to Lyon.
